ORGANIZATION: Africa Health Organisation (AHO)

Description

Help us engage our audiences by upgrading our email marketing tools and creating compelling email and newsletter content so that we can achieve optimum health for people in Africa and the Diaspora.

Our charity delivers health and social care in Africa and the Diaspora. We are urgently looking for an experienced email marketing expert to work with us as we respond to Covid-19.

Duties and Responsibilities

We would like the volunteer to help with:

  • Email content: Write compelling email content that is short, relevant and has clear a call-to-action and high click through rates
  • Email marketing software: Recommend and set up an email marketing system (SendGrid, Mailchimp, etc) that represents good value for money and is the right fit for our organisation
  • Email templates: Customise an off the shelf template tot matches our branding. Graphic design skills will be a bonus.
  • GDPR compliance: Advise us on how we can keep our mailing lists current and GDPR compliant
  • Email strategy: Help us plan and articulate how we can use emails and newsletters to strengthen our brand, motivate our supporters and communicate with our stakeholders.

You will be working with the CEO who will provide an overview of our existing communication and marketing materials, as well as our brand guidelines. You will work together to produce initial concepts for all deliverables, including goals, target audience, and desired tone and style of writing.

Skills and qualifications

We are looking for a volunteer who has:

  • Experience using email marketing software (such as Mailchimp)
  • Experience setting up email templates in line with existing brand
  • Ability to quickly understand the needs of our organisation and users
  • Can ask key questions to enable us to clarify requirements
  • Understands the resource constraints of a small charity and is able to work with these.
  • Open to feedback
  • Qualification in digital social media, marketing, journalism, etc

Your input will shape how we present ourselves to our service users, stakeholders, funders and general public. With your help we will be able to continue to deliver our health and social care services and how they help our end users.

You would become part of our small, friendly team and you have the opportunity to use your time to make a real difference in difficult times.

The volunteer can work entirely from home and we can consider remote candidates from across the UK and the globe.
